On my Ubuntu 18.04LTS (RTX 2060) Krita 4.3.0 picking wrong color with factory settings. There is no opacity in layer or brush. I am really confused because I started actively using Krita recently…
Hi
Select Color picker tool, go in tools options, and ensure that radius is set to 1px, and blend at 100%
These tools setting are used when you pick color.

Also see if it is because of a layer above. I sometimes get the wrong colour, because I have a layer above set to a blending mode or something like that!
If you want to color pick from ONLY the current layer, take a look here:
Setting -> Configure Krita -> Canvas Input Settings -> Alternate Invocation, there you can see what shortcut you can use for “Pick Foreground Color from Current Layer”, that will pick the current layer’s color, not the whole image including layers above! (I don’t remember the default one as I changed mine)

I use the shortcut ‘brush tool + ctrl’ a lot to pick colors.
However, when I’m in a multiply layer, the collected color is darker. So I found out now that I can add another shortcut.
For example: ‘Brush tool + ctrl + right button’
